The assignment forms replace the upper or lower … WebD = diag (v) returns a square diagonal matrix with vector v as the main diagonal. example. D = diag (v,k) places vector v on the k th diagonal. k = 0 represents the main diagonal, k > 0 is above the main diagonal, and k < 0 is below the main diagonal. example. x = diag (A) returns the main diagonal of A.

If x is a matrix then diag (x) returns the diagonal of x. The resulting vector will have names if the matrix x has matching column and rownames. The replacement form sets the diagonal of the matrix x to the given value (s).
